Hospital volunteer requirements
- Be age 18 or older
- Commit to a minimum of four hours per week for a period of at least six months; shifts are available Sunday through Saturday, from approximately 6:00am until 8:00pm
- Complete medical prerequisites and training before their start date
How to become a hospital volunteer
- Complete our online volunteer application and agreement
- Candidates whose applications are accepted after an interview* will need to provide or complete:
- Health certificate signed by their physician
- Proof of immunities and vaccinations
- Criminal background check
- Two-part tuberculosis test (offered by the hospital free of charge to adult volunteers)
- Attend a four-hour orientation and training session
* Applicants will be contacted for an interview only if there is a volunteer opportunity available.
Areas of volunteer service**
Information desk
Greet and assist patients, visitors, and vendors either in person or on the phone
Emergency department
Keep supplies stocked for our medical staff and meet and direct patients and their families as they arrive.
Work the cash register, help set up displays and assist customers
Book and newspaper cart
Deliver newspapers, books, magazines, patient mail and flowers to inpatient units
Coffee cart
Serve light refreshments, cookies and fruits to patients and families
**Areas of volunteer service may be restricted at any time, as needed.
Other volunteer assignments
Volunteers may find additional opportunities within our cardiovascular, occupational therapy, physical therapy, pastoral care and community benefit departments. Sometimes we also need assistance with courtesy vehicles and in our mailroom, storeroom, Foundation and business office.
